Whence comes this interest? At
first it seldom comes naturally;
a mere sense of duty1 must create
it. Presently, the quick, curious,
restless spirit of science enlivens
it; and then the deliberate
choice of the mind.
“When the interest of attend-
ing the sick has reached this
point, there arises from it a
ready discernment of disease
and a skill in the use of reme-
dies. — And the skill exalts the
interest, and the interest im-
proves the skill, until in process
of time, experience forms the
consummate practitioner.
“But does the interest of at-
tending the sick necessarily stop
here? No. What if humanity
shall warm it? Then this inter-
est, this excitement, this intel-
lectual pleasure is exalted into
a principle invested into a mo-
ral motive, and passes into the
heart. . . .”
